This is a study of initiation into the New Testament, which attempts to reveal a synthesis of the 'liberal' emphasis on repentance, the 'evangelical' emphasis on faith, the 'sacramental' on baptism and the 'Pentecostal' on the Spirit. These 'four spiritual doors' are then related to conversion and regeneration. The second section provides an exegetical study of two dozen crucial or controversial passages, questioning many traditional interpretations. The final section on pastoral application demonstrates the inadequacy of much modern evangelistic counseling.

In this book, David Pawson calls the church back to the very heart of the good news. For many, the 'gospel' is that God loves everybody unconditionally. Yet neither Jesus nor his apostles ever preached like that. They seem to have thought that the world needed to know about his righteousness and his willingness, even his eagerness, to share that with us. That is because he is determined to have a universe in which there is no unrighteousness whatever. Why don't we think that is good news?

Christians everywhere await Christ's return. Will he come as the pre-existent Son of God or the incarnate Son of man? To the whole world or just one place? In the same way as the first time or otherwise? Soon and suddenly or after clear signs? What can he achieve by coming back and how long will it take? These and many other questions are tackled in this book.

It is a detailed analysis of the two major areas of controversy, the 'Rapture' and the 'Millennium', followed by a look at other related issues - the application of unfulfilled predictions in the Old Testament, the nature of the kingdom in the teaching of Jesus and the future of Israel and the biblical philosophy of history. The final section attempts a new approach to the interpretation of the 'Book of Revelations'.

Many preachers are reluctant to explain what the Bible teaches about hell. David Pawson sets out clearly the teaching of the New Testament on this vital topic. The book includes a section of ‘Scripture Studies’ which are useful for personal and group study and to equip preachers.

Most of Christ’s teaching on this uncomfortable subject was addressed to his followers, yet it hardly features in sermons today. Challenging the modern alternatives of liberal ‘universalism’ and evangelical ‘annihilationism’, David Pawson presents the traditional concept of endless torment as soundly biblical, illustrating his argument with in-depth Scripture studies on controversial passages. Heaven is also a reality, he affirms, but it is hell which is being overlooked.
‘Hell is the most offensive and least acceptable of all Christian doctrines. We try to ignore it but it won’t go away. Better to face the truth, even if it hurts.’ ‘I am convinced that the recovery of this neglected truth is vital to the health of Christ’s body.’ David Pawson
